About Quinnipiac
Quinnipiac University is a private, coeducational institution located 90 minutes north of New York City and two hours from Boston. The university enrolls 9,700 students in more than 100-degree programs through its Schools of Business, Communications, Computing & Engineering, Education, Health Sciences, Law, Medicine, Nursing, and the College of Arts & Sciences. Quinnipiac’s 22 Division I teams have achieved national and conference titles, including a 2023 NCAA national championship in men's ice hockey. The Quinnipiac University Poll is nationally recognized for public opinion research. The university is consistently ranked by U.S. News & World Report, Princeton Review, and The Wall Street Journal (#51 nationally, #2 in Connecticut) for its graduation rate, salary impact, facilities, and career preparation. Quinnipiac is expanding programs for traditional and adult learners, developing strategic partnerships, and recently opened South Quad with three state-of-the-art buildings.
